我有一个软件,它根据用户的选择将一些数据写入内存中的特定位置。假设我可以有 2 个选择,A 和 B。我想运行 IDA,设置选项 A 并保存所有数据,然后使用选项 B 再次运行它并保存,然后比较 2。
我可以这样做吗?
如何?
您所要求的称为“差异调试”。看看本教程,看看如何使用 IDA 做到这一点,而无需任何类型的插件,只需内置功能。
您可以在两种情况下收集代码覆盖率,然后通过像灯塔这样的 ida 插件进行比较